Welcome to Nutanix, Vancouver!The Opportunity Join our team at Nutanix as a Member of Technical Staff 3, where you will play a crucial role in providing a solid Nutanix Cloud Manager (NCM) product to our customers.
Your mission will be to build an observability platform that allows our customers to proactively monitor and manage their infrastructure and applications. By building a reliable NCM data platform and driving the adoption of best practices, you will contribute to the success of our products. This is a unique opportunity to work with cutting-edge technologies, learn from experienced mentors, and be part of a fast-paced environment where autonomy and ownership are valued. The work will range from analyzing application requirements and proposing and benchmarking databases, designing data processing pipelines to data analysis and recommending best practices based on workload.
Engineering / R&D at Nutanix The NCM data platform provides an end-to-end telemetry platform that includes telemetry data collection via agents and a big data pipeline that provides capabilities such as data transformation/processing, data warehousing, and data analytics. The NCM data platform is a team of 12 people, spread across India and the US, with a mix of senior and junior engineers. The team is special because it works in a hybrid environment, prioritizing fast deliverables while dedicating time for cross-geo collaboration.
The team's success lies in its ability to bring together diverse skill sets and work towards building a unified experience for Nutanix customers.
